Q:   What is the selection criteria for Symbiosis Centre for Skill Development?
A: 

Symbiosis Centre for Skill Development shortlists students based on various parameters. This may differ from course to course, as for certain courses, the college accepts applicants on a rolling basis while further rounds, such as PI screening is taken into consideration for other programmes. Take a look at the table below to learn all about the selection criteria for the popular offered courses:

Course

Selection Criteria

BVoc

Merit + PI Screening

UG Diploma

Merit + PI Screening

PG Diploma

Merit + PI Screening

Certificate

Merit/ PI

Q:   How can I get into Shri Bapusaheb D Vispute College Of Education for UG/PG courses? Am I eligible for admission?
A: 
Shri Bapusaheb D Vispute College Of Education has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
CoursesEligibility
M.EdCandidate must have obtained at least mentioned marks or an Equivalent Grade in any one of the following programme (Minimum 45% marks in case of Backward Class categories from the State of Maharashtra belonging to SC, ST, VJ/DT*- NT (A)*, NT (B)*, NT (C)*, NT (D)*, OBC*, SBC* Categories having Caste Certificate, Caste Validity and Valid Non Creamy Layer Certificate* valid up to 31 March 2024 ) (i) B.Ed. (ii) B.A.-B.Ed./, B.Sc.-B.Ed. (Four Year Integrated Course) (iii) B.El.Ed. (iv) D.El.Ed./D.T.Ed. with an Undergraduate Degree with 50% marks in Each Course (Minimum 45% Marks in case of Backward Class Categories from the State of Maharashtra only). Candidates who are Appearing/ have appeared for the Qualifying Examination will be eligible for Admission only if they produce the provisional/Degree Certificate of the Qualifying Examination.
B.EdCandidates who wants to take admission in the English Medium Colleges will have to appear for English Language Content Test (ELCT) also. There is no upper age limit for admission to MAH-B.Ed. CET Examination in the Academic Year 2023-2024. Age will be calculated as on 1st July 2023.
